Dudinka vs Primorsko-Ahtarsk Climate & Distance Between

Russia flag
  • The distance between Dudinka, Russia and Primorsko-Ahtarsk, Russia is approximately 3,688 km or 2,292 mi.
  • To reach Dudinka in this distance one would set out from Primorsko-Ahtarsk bearing 28.6°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Dudinka bearing 70.6° or ENE .
  • Dudinka has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Primorsko-Ahtarsk has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
  • Dudinka is in or near the subpolar moist tundra biome whereas Primorsko-Ahtarsk is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
  • The mean temperature is 21.3 °C (38.3°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 16.5 °C (29.7°F) more in Dudinka.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to subcontinental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 61.6 mm (2.4 in) less which is equivalent to 61.6 l/m² (1.51 US gal/ft²) or 616,000 l/ha (65,854 US gal/ac) less. About 8/9 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 23.3° lower in Dudinka than in Primorsko-Ahtarsk.
